Transaction 905f9109144bb50734254c1d5bb12751e049b75414049b8fb7bba8ab90bdad43
1 Input
1 Output
-
905f9109144bb50734254c1d5bb12751e049b75414049b8fb7bba8ab90bdad43:0
- value
- 563950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6c3c1dd2aba4a6d3179ab120e92e8ffe8e472da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K7yJSLFHRqpoUmTbG4R3i5yzowYpcTUhr